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 222 7898653 439785741
21 48435584702 83392767
21 48435584702 83392767
6108248330 5946 4993524374
All about undefined
Interested in learning more?
21 48435584702 83392767
6108248330 5946 4993524374
See more
9343 28 477976
106 02732840050 36
See more
559155 7286297
00 62053687 32126454290 24418
See more